Key Industries Driving Growth
The diamond cutting and polishing industry stands as a hallmark of Surat’s economy. As the world’s largest diamond processing center, Surat processes over 90% of India’s diamonds, adding substantial value to the city’s economy. Besides diamonds, the textile industry is another cornerstone of Surat’s economic strength. The city is famous for its production of synthetic textiles, including sarees and dress materials, contributing significantly to both local employment and export earnings.

Key Economic Indicators of Surat
Gross Domestic Product Overview
Surat’s GDP has shown remarkable growth, solidifying its position as one of India’s rapidly growing cities. The GDP of Surat was estimated to be around $40 billion in recent assessments, marking it as an economic powerhouse within the country. Future projections suggest a steady rise, particularly with ongoing investments in infrastructure and industrial development aimed at further boosting its economic output.
Employment Statistics and Labor Force
With approximately 1.9 million workers, Surat boasts a diverse labor force primarily engaged in manufacturing and services. The city’s economy is characterized by an emerging trend toward skilled labor, especially in sectors such as information technology and finance. Employment opportunities continue to expand with the growth of newer industries, reducing unemployment rates and enhancing the quality of life for residents.

Diamond Cutting and Polishing Sector Insights
The diamond cutting and polishing sector is integral to Surat’s identity. The city houses thousands of diamond processing units, which employ a large workforce and contribute significantly to the local economy. Innovations in cutting technology and skilled craftsmanship have positioned Surat as a key player in the global diamond market, leading to increased investment in training and resources within this sector.

Government Initiatives and Economic Policies
Recent Economic Development Programs
The government of Gujarat has rolled out various economic development programs aimed at bolstering Surat’s economy. Initiatives such as the “Viksit Gujarat 2047” plan aim to transform the city into a $1.3 trillion economy, focusing on labor-intensive sectors and job creation. The government actively collaborates with industries to create a conducive environment for growth, encouraging both domestic and international investments.
Infrastructure Investments Impacting surat economy
Infrastructure development is critical to Surat’s economic growth. Significant investments have been made in road networking, public transportation, and utilities to support industrial expansion. The implementation of the Surat Metro project is a landmark initiative that promises to alleviate traffic congestion and improve connectivity, thereby enhancing the overall business environment.
